Positive Parenting - According to Quran & Sunnah

Dr. Rida Beshir and Dr. Ekram Beshir are a husband-wife team, they will be holding a parenting workshop event. Dr. Mohamed Rida Beshir is a leading expert in the area of parenting and family issues from an Islamic perspective, and he is the author of the best-sellers, “When Muslim Teens Rebel: Causes and Solutions” and “Family Leadership (Qawama) an Obligation to Fulfill, not an Excuse to Abuse”. In addition he has co-authored many other best-selling books on family issues and parenting with his wife, among them: “Meeting the Challenge of Parenting in the West: an Islamic Perspective”, Muslim Teens: Today’s Worry, Tomorrow’s Hope, a Practical Islamic Parenting Guide”, “Blissful Marriage”, and “Parenting Skills based on Qur’an and Sunnah”, as well as other parenting books in Arabic. Some of their books have been translated into several languages such as French, German and Albanian and currently being translated into other languages. Dr. Beshir has taught many courses on the subject of parenting in North American society with the Islamic American University. He is a regular contributor to the family section of various Muslim magazines, including Islamic Horizons, The Message, and American Muslim. He was also an advisor for the original Islam Online website’s family section. Dr. Beshir has conducted over a thousand workshops on parenting, marriage and tarbiyah matters throughout the world (North America, Europe, Australia, South Africa, Morocco, and Malaysia). He is the recipient of the City of Ottawa Certificate of Appreciation for 2003 for his volunteer work in the area of education. He recently founded www.familydawn.com, a comprehensive family website with a collection of articles, case studies, frequently asked questions, and resources on Islamic family matters. Although Dr. Beshir is an Engineer by profession, in his quest for authentic and classical Islamic knowledge, he has studied with great Islamic scholars and students of knowledge in the areas of Tafseer, Fiqh, Usool Al Fiqh, Tarbiyah and other Islamic subjects. During his visit to South Africa in Nov./Dec. 2015, he was interviewed by many Islamic radio stations as well as TV channels. The South African Islamic TV produced a series of seven hours of interviews on parenting and marital issues with Dr. Beshir. He was interviewed four times by the famous Deen Show of Chicago during 2014 and 2015. He has participated and led many Islamic outreach and Dawah projects as well as numerous community development initiatives on the local and national level in North America over the past 4 decades. He is a member of the International Union of Muslim Scholars. He has held various elected positions with MSA, ISNA, and MAS on both national and local levels. He led the training and development department of the Muslim American Society (MAS) for over 6 years, and was a member for the department for 2 decades. He is a regular speaker at ISNA, ICNA, MSA and MAS conferences. He is a recipient of the Ottawa Muslim Association Volunteer award for his contribution to the Ottawa Muslim Community. He is a recipient of the Ottawa Muslim Circle award for his contribution to the Circle. He is a member of the advisory board of SIFCA, the “Shura of Islamic Family Counselors of America”. He is one of the founding members of HCI “Human Concern International” and served for over a decade as the vice president of HCI. Dr. Ekram Beshir came to North America in 1975 to join her husband. They were blessed with 4 children whom they raised to be dedicated and active Muslim workers. As a wife/husband team, they together authored several bestselling parenting, marriage, and family books in North America, among them, “Meeting the Challenge of Parenting in the West, an Islamic Perspective,” “Muslim Teens, Today’s Worry, Tomorrow’s Hope, a Practical Islamic Parenting Guide,” “Blissful Marriage,” and “Parenting Skills based on Qur’an and Sunnah,” as well as other parenting books in Arabic. Some of their parenting books have been translated to French, German and Albanian and are currently being translated to Malaysian, Bosnian, Indonesian, and other languages. They taught two courses on the subject of “Parenting in North America” with the Islamic American University. Both are regular contributors to the Family Section of several magazines, including “The American Muslim,” “Islamic Horizons,” “The Message,” and “Muslim Family”. Dr. Ekram with her husband Dr. Mohamed Beshir are the recipients of the City of Ottawa Certificate of Appreciation for the year 2003 for their volunteer work in the area of Education as well as other City of Ottawa awards for valuable services to community children in the year 2006. She has traveled extensively, presenting workshops to various Muslim communities all over the world. She is a medical doctor by profession, with a background in child psychology. She is the founder of both Abraar full time Islamic school and Rahma School, a weekend Arabic and Islamic school, in Ottawa, Canada. She is the recipient of the Director’s Citation Award of the Ottawa-Carleton District School Board for the year 2000 for her contribution in the area of education from among 7000 employees of the board. She is the winner of Muslim Association of Canada special “Mother of the Community” award for the year 2016. She has been very active with the Muslim community in Ottawa in the areas of study circles, children and youth camps, sisters programs, and marriage counseling. She has traveled extensively to various parts of the world to present parenting and marriage workshops. She has also authored other books for teaching Arabic to Muslim children living in Non- Arabic speaking countries.

Muslim Americans in the Military with Edward Curtis

Since the Revolutionary War, Muslim Americans have served in the United States military, risking their lives to defend a country that increasingly looks at them with suspicion and fear. In Muslim Americans in the Military: Centuries of Service, Edward Curtis illuminates the long history of Muslim service members who have defended their country and struggled to practice their faith. Profiling soldiers, marines, airmen, and sailors since the dawn of our country, Curtis showcases the real stories of Muslim Americans, from Omer Otmen, who fought fiercely against German forces during World War I, to Captain Humayun Khan, who gave his life in Iraq in 2004. These true stories contradict the narratives of hate and fear that have dominated recent headlines, revealing the contributions and sacrifices that these soldiers have made to the United States. About Edward Curtis Award-winning author Edward Curtis is recognized as a leading scholar on Islam and Muslims in the United States. His nine books on the subject have been called “essential,” “exemplary,” “approachable,” “groundbreaking,” “must-read,” “wonderful,” and “a model of clarity.” Curtis' Muslims in America: A Short History (Oxford, 2009) was named one of the best 100 books of 2009 by Publishers Weekly. He is Millennium Chair of the Liberal Arts and Professor of Religious Studies at the Indiana University School of Liberal Arts in Indianapolis. For more information, see www.edward-curtis.com.

Lessons from Gaza, Palestine with Mohammed Omer

2016 marks ten years since Israel imposed a military blockade on Gaza, adding an urgency to generate greater awareness of realities on the ground and create political movement to end the blockade in the United States. In the shadow of the election of Donald Trump as US president, the likelihood of more such attacks has increased and the lessons from Gaza for resisting occupation, state terror, and state-supported racism are all the more urgent. Mohammed Omer, 32, is among the younger generation of Palestinian writers who work to narrate their own reality, despite the isolation and global indifference to their lives under military occupation. Mohammed Omer began translating and writing at age 17 from Rafah (Gaza), and has since become an award-winning author and journalist covering life for Palestinians in Gaza for numerous publications including Al Jazeera, The Nation, Electronic Intifada, Middle East Eye, and numerous European news outlets. His latest book, Shell Shocked: On the Ground Under Israeli Assault will be available for sale during the event.

Recitation and Dinner With Qari Muhammad Jebril

Sheikh Muhammad Jebril graduated from Al-Azhar University in Egypt in Sharia Law and has lead Ramadan Taraweeh prayers in Masjid Amr Bin Al-Aas in Cairo since 1988, where more than seven million Muslims pray behind him every year. He is among the most prominent reciters of the Holy Quran in the world. He won the Best Quranic Reciter in the World in 2007 as well as international Quran competitions in Saudi Arabia, Malaysia, and Bahrain. He is listened to by over three million people daily on Jebril Radio. He is the number one person in the world who people want to listen to his Dua’s. Sheikh Jebril has served as an instructor of the Qur’an at the University of Jordan and has prepared religious programs for Jordanian Television. He has traveled the world to lead worshipers in mosques and delivered lectures at Islamic centers in Quranic Studies. He has recorded the Holy Qur’an for radio and television broadcasts for Egyptian Television and many Arab television networks.
